I just received an ipower 6in inline exhaust system kit for my 4x4x6.5' tent. I found that it doesn't have a fan control setting so it's just plug and go. It's a 443cfm fan. I recognized that after setting up and closing my tent, there's a very clear suction effect going on with my tent. When you look at the tent you can see how it's sucking it pretty noticeably. Now I do have a small fan blowing in creating an active intake but it's very weak compared to the exhaust so my question is....is there any negative issues with having a strong negative pressure system in the tent? There is not a strong breeze that could hurt the plants or anything actually it's hard to even see the plants moving from it. Just looks very odd when looking at the tent from the outside lol I bought an adaptable fan speed controller that goes in right at the socket so I will eventually have slow medium and high. Just wanted some opinions if I'm endangering my girls at all. All of which are still seedlings. Thanks!
